1.3 Intended use

Use the appliance only indoors.

The appliance has been designed specifically for domestic use. It must only be used to heat water. Do not use the appliance for anything other than its intended use.

The appliance is not designed to operate with external timers or with remote-control systems.

This appliance may not be used by people of reduced physical, sensory or mental capacity, or without sufficient experience and knowledge (including children), unless they are supervised or instructed by adults who are responsible for their safety.

Children must never play with the appliance. Keep the appliance out of children’s reach.

For this appliance

The kettle can get very hot during operation. Do not touch the hot surfaces. Use the handle.

Do not use the kettle if the handle is loose.

Do not operate the kettle on an inclined plane.

Do not leave the kettle unsupervised while it is on.

Do not operate the kettle unless the element is fully immersed.

Do not move the kettle while it is switched on.

Unplug the kettle when it is not being used, before cleaning and if you notice any fault. Let the appliance cool down before cleaning.

Always use the kettle with the scale filter fitted.

Do not overfill the kettle (max. 1.7 litres), otherwise boiling water may spray out. If the kettle is overfilled, boiling water may be ejected.

The heating element surface is subject to residual heat after use.

Only use the kettle to boil water. Never fill the kettle with other liquids.

Do not open the kettle’s lid while it is on.

Check that the lid is correctly closed before turning on the kettle.

Use the kettle only with the supplied base.

Do not use the kettle on bases from other manufacturers.

Only place the base on level surfaces.

Only use original spare parts. The use of spare parts not approved by the manufacturer could lead to fires, electric shocks or personal injury.

To prevent damage to the appliance do not use alkaline cleaning agents when cleaning, use a soft cloth and a mild detergent.

Do not use metal implements or scouring pads to clean the inside of the kettle. Only use products specifically designed for the purpose.

Empty the kettle before you use it each time: if residual water is left inside, this could lead to scale building up.

This appliance can be used by children aged from 8 years and above if they have been given supervision or instruction concerning use of the appliance in a safe way and if they understand the hazards involved.

Cleaning and maintenance must never be performed by children unless they are older than 8 and supervised.

Keep the kettle and its power cord out of the reach of children aged less than 8 years.

Do not allow children to play with the appliance.
